"This book has all the great orchestral hits including Blue Danube, Beethoven's 5th, Ode to Joy, Surprise Sypmhony, Hall of the Mountain King, Fur Elise, Morning Mood and many more. You get lots of mileage of out of this book. Most students play 75% of the book. "
